    It's an ok built. I don't wanna sound to negative. There is no blue on the GRU-7 Ejection Seats, it's rather a slightly blueish grey. The windshield is completely botched - you are aware that the pilot has to look through it, right? ;)
    The dirt spots on the bottom of the external fuel tanks are to strong imho, whereas the dark cussions in front of the tailfins where the wings slide over when being folded, could use some weathering. The postion lights on the ports side are green and not blue + you forgot to paint the bottom fuselage one (see 52:25). And the "201" decal on the nose is missing. The decals on the Phoenix are on the side not on the bottom. 😕

    You are a superb modeler but i must raise one major critic that no one dare to raise so far. You use way way to much paint flow or a wrong presure settings on your airbrush, which causes the painting finish to look grainy and "spitted". I watched many videos of yours and you use the same technique. Most of the modelers use much less amount of paint and pressure, which results to more even and smooth finish.
